Welcome to your off-grid tent site!

WHAT YOU WILL FIND:

The camping area has recently received a refreshing makeover with fresh mulch that is gradually enriching the soil with essential nutrients for the surrounding trees. While privacy within the campsite might be a bit of a challenge with the open layout, a serene escape into the nearby forest can offer the solitude you seek. The thoughtful provision of a privacy fence around the outdoor shower area and a secluded composting toilet nestled among the trees ensures a comfortable camping experience.

Although summers may bring the heat, dust, and pesky mosquitoes due to the proximity to the nearby lake, the allure of this campsite surpasses any minor inconveniences. Additional Rules

  • No fires during burn bans.

  • If you smoke, do it on gravel only and use an ashtray.

  • Trash bin in the bus is the only place trash can go on the property. So please be aware and take trash off property if you have a lot of trash. If it is put outside, it will attract unwanted wildlife and it will be unsafe for future guests.

  • Pick up after your pets.

  • Please be mindful of water on floor near shower.
